Heading towards the Galician coast, we set off to discover some of the most impressive corners of northern Spain: the magnificent Playa de las Catedrales, where, as the tide goes out, the sea exposes a natural cathedral that opens to the sky. Another stop will be Isla Pancha, an island that looks like it was taken from a postcard. From its viewpoint, you will enjoy a unique panorama. Ribadeo will surprise us with its rich history and architecture We will take a guided tour and at the end, you will have free time to discover at your own pace and taste some of the most representative dishes of the local seafood cuisine. Then we will stop at Tapia de Casariego. Walk through its harbour and enjoy the calm of the landscape. Reserved and unrestricted access to Playa de las Catedrals. Enjoy free time to explore at your own pace the interior of the beach, its stunning cliffs and the trails that run along the coast. Possibility of swimming in the Playa de las Catedrals. Don’t forget to bring your swimsuit and enjoy the sea if conditions allow!
Guided tour of the most emblematic places of Ribadeo. Free time to explore at your own pace, with the opportunity to enjoy typical Galician cuisine during lunch.
Stop at Isla Pancha, where you can enjoy the stunning views and the iconic lighthouse overlooking it.
Stop and visit Tapia de Casariego, a charming coastal town known for its picturesque fishing port and seafaring atmosphere. Possibility of swimming in Tapia de Casariego, if the weather permits, you can enjoy a dip in its beaches. Don't forget your swimsuit!
Stop to visit the Lighthouse of San Agustín, main lighthouse of Ortigueira.

I made the excursion to Playa de las Catedrals and overall it was a good experience. The place is spectacular and totally worth the visit. The guide was friendly and the organization was fine overall. However, I would like to point out that during the stop in Tapia de Casariego and in the last villages of the tour, the heat at those hours was quite intense, which made the walks somewhat heavy. In those stretches, the walking time in the sun was excessive and planning could be improved to avoid the hottest hours or reduce exposure time. Even so, it is a recommended excursion if prepared with sun protection, water and comfortable footwear. The Playa de las Catedrals is undoubtedly the highlight of the tour.
